NovaRed Mining Enters Standstill Agreement with EyeX LLC
Canadian mineral exploration firm NovaRed Mining Inc. has formalized a standstill agreement with Florida-based EyeX LLC, allowing both entities a 30-day due diligence period. This agreement centers on the potential acquisition of EyeX’s artificial intelligence surveillance technology.
EyeX’s AI system is engineered to autonomously monitor surveillance cameras and drones, detecting risks in real time without continuous human supervision. This capability is anticipated to enhance NovaRed’s mineral exploration operations. Financial terms and detailed acquisition plans remain undisclosed.
Valentin Saitarli Joins NovaRed as Chief Technology Officer
To strengthen its technological expertise, NovaRed has appointed Valentin Saitarli as Chief Technology Officer. With over ten years of experience in artificial intelligence and machine learning, Mr. Saitarli co-founded EyeX LLC and previously led its technology strategy and product development.
His proficiency in AI-driven visual intelligence is expected to advance NovaRed’s exploration efficiency. Mr. Saitarli’s prior roles at Infosys, Apple, and Uber, combined with academic credentials from MIT and Stanford, make him a vital addition to NovaRed’s leadership.

Strategic Name Change Reflecting AI Focus
NovaRed intends to rebrand as NRED Intelligent Mining Inc., reflecting its commitment to embedding artificial intelligence within its mineral exploration processes. This name change awaits regulatory approval, with updates to be provided upon finalization.
The company confirmed that the name change will not impact shareholder rights or require any shareholder action. No alterations to the capital structure were mentioned.

Core Operations and Project Focus
NovaRed Mining Inc. specializes in exploring and developing copper-gold porphyry projects in British Columbia. Its flagship Wilmac copper-gold project covers 16,078 hectares within the Quesnel porphyry belt, situated near Hudbay Minerals Inc.’s Copper Mountain Mine.
The company employs an AI-enhanced geospatial platform to identify and assess promising mineral properties. No production or financial data were disclosed.
